2. Web Scraping and Lead Intelligence
Another proven route to amplifying quality lead generation is identifying buyer personas already actively seeking solutions online.
This is where web scraping and lead intelligence tools shine by capturing rich behavioral signals otherwise buried in volumes of unstructured publicly available data.
Web scraping structures such anonymous website traffic and search data into segmented, analysis-ready databases filtered by keywords, attributes, and parameters configured to user needs.
Lead intelligence platforms then enrich these scraped lead insights with accurate firmographic details and contact info matched to each anonymous prospect through identity graph technology.
Together, web scraping and lead enrichment empower businesses to:
- Target buyers actively researching or requesting relevant products/services
- Segment anonymous prospects by industry, company size, tech stack details and other attributes
- Append accurate contact info to turn unknown website visitors into sales-ready leads
Top platforms like LeadSift, LeadGenius, ZoomInfo and HubSpot integrate customized web scraping capabilities with advanced lead filters and append tools to automate lead intelligence workflows.
These simplify converting digital footprints into vetted contacts equipped with deep contextual insights to accelerate lead conversion rates.

3. Conversational Chatbots
Another proven technology to increase conversion rates from high-intent site traffic is AI-powered chatbots.
Chatbots qualify leads 24/7 by:
- Greeting all visitors automatically
- Answering common questions in real time
- Capturing lead details proactively through quizzes or questionnaires
- Routing hot, sales-ready leads directly to representatives
This alleviates bottlenecks from overburdened teams unable to manually engage all visitors quickly enough. It also dramatically reduces response times, which is critical given:
- 53% of site visitors will exit prematurely if their questions aren‘t addressed immediately, according to Kayako.
- 60% of businesses still can‘t respond to online queries fast enough, missing countless conversion opportunities, notes SmallBizGenius. The average first response time is a sluggish 42 hours.
Advanced platforms like Intercom, Drift, Ada, Tidio and LiveChat support automated lead capturing at scale with AI-powered chatbot options. Users praise their intuitive interfaces, built-in analytics and seamless CRM integrations to feed leads directly into downstream nurturing workflows.

Key Performance Metrics to Track
While the technologies and techniques powering modern lead generation progress swiftly, tried-and-true KPIs remain reliable indicators of success:
Volume KPIs
- Lead capture rate: Percentage of prospects converted from anonymous to known contacts
- Cost per lead (CPL): Average spend required per lead
- Monthly/quarterly lead target: Track lead acquisition momentum
Quality KPIs
- Lead to customer conversion rate: Percentage of leads turning into sales
- Deal size by source: Track average order value indicators
- Customer lifetime value: Project earnings from newly-acquired customers
Efficiency KPIs
- Time-to-convert: How long from initial lead capture to closed deal
- Sales team capacity: Number of productive lead follow-ups conducted monthly
- Marketing ROI: Ratio of profit/revenue to lead gen spending
While no two businesses have identical KPI frameworks, tracking a cross-section of volume, quality and efficiency metrics remains crucial for optimizing systems, operations and spending around what works.
